Abstract

179,947. Zack, M. May 11, 1921, [Convention date]. No Patent granted (Sealing feenot paid). Separating gaseous mixtures by liquefaction. - Argon is obtained from liquid air or liquid raw oxygen by partial evaporation, the residual liquid being subjected to reduced pressure ; the liquid portion and the evaporate are each separated into a liquid and a vapour. In the apparatus shown, liquid air is supplied to a vessel a; the vapour formed therein passee by a pipe m to one compartment, provided with baffles, of a second contained f, while the liquid passes to the lower part g of the other compartment of the second container. The part g is connected with theupper part i of the second container by tubes h, the parts g, h, i being under vacuum or reduced pressure. Liquid outlets q, r and gas outlets o, p are provided.
